White lies. Dark humor. Deadly consequences… Bestselling sensation
Juniper Song is not who she says she is, she didn’t write the book she
claims she wrote, and she is most certainly not Asian American–in this
chilling and hilariously cutting novel from R.F. Kuang, the #1 New York
Times bestselling author of Babel. Authors June Hayward and Athena Liu were
supposed to be twin rising stars. But Athena’s a literary darling. June
Hayward is literally nobody. Who wants stories about basic white girls,
June thinks. So when June witnesses Athena’s death in a freak accident, she
acts on impulse: she steals Athena’s just-finished masterpiece, an
experimental novel about the unsung contributions of Chinese laborers
during World War I. So what if June edits Athena’s novel and sends it to
her agent as her own work? So what if she lets her new publisher rebrand
her as Juniper Song–complete with an ambiguously ethnic author photo?
Doesn’t this piece of history deserve to be told, whoever the teller?
That’s what June claims, and the New York Times bestseller list seems to
agree. But June can’t get away from Athena’s shadow, and emerging evidence
threatens to bring June’s (stolen) success down around her. As June races
to protect her secret, she discovers exactly how far she will go to keep
what she thinks she deserves. With its totally immersive first-person
voice, Yellowface grapples with questions of diversity, racism, and
cultural appropriation, as well as the terrifying alienation of social
media. R.F. Kuang’s novel is timely, razor-sharp, and eminently readable.
